What is Coconut Shisha Hookah Charcoal?
Coconut shisha hookah charcoal is a type of charcoal specifically made from the husks of coconuts. It is a popular choice among hookah smokers due to its clean-burning properties and the absence of harmful chemicals. Unlike traditional charcoals, which often contain additives, coconut charcoal offers a more natural experience, making it ideal for enjoying flavored shisha. This charcoal is produced through a unique process that maximizes its efficiency and sustainability.
Production Process of Coconut Charcoal
The production of coconut charcoal involves several crucial steps:
- Harvesting: The first step in creating coconut charcoal is the harvesting of mature coconuts. The husks are separated from the coconut shells, which are then dried to reduce moisture content.
- Carbonization: The dried husks are subjected to high temperatures in an oxygen-controlled environment. This process, known as carbonization, converts the organic matter into charcoal while maintaining the structural integrity and surface area of the material.
- Cooling and Crushing: Once carbonized, the charcoal is cooled down and crushed to the desired granule size suitable for hookah use.
- Packaging: Finally, the coconut shisha hookah charcoal is packed and distributed to retailers and customers around the world.
Benefits of Using Coconut Shisha Hookah Charcoal
The advantages of coconut shisha hookah charcoal extend beyond its clean-burning capabilities. Here are some notable benefits:
- Eco-Friendly: Made from renewable coconut resources, this charcoal is a more sustainable choice compared to traditional wood charcoal. The use of coconut husks also promotes waste reduction.
- Minimal Ash Production: Coconut charcoal produces significantly less ash than regular charcoal, which means a cleaner and more enjoyable smoking experience.
- Longer Burn Time: It tends to last longer than other charcoal types, providing extended sessions without the need for constant replacements.
- Neutral Flavor: Unlike some charcoals that can impart flavors to the smoke, coconut charcoal provides a neutral base, enhancing the natural taste of shisha.
- Consistent Heat: It offers a steady and consistent heat output, which is crucial for optimal flavor extraction from hookah tobacco.
